The route from Daryapur to Latur covers approximately 400 kilometers, traversing the heart of the Marathwada region. You will likely pass through Akola, Washim, and Hingoli before heading south towards Latur. This is a long-distance journey that typically takes 9 to 10 hours by road. While there is no direct train, the road connectivity is reliable for private vehicles and state transport buses. Latur is a major educational and agricultural hub, making it a significant transit point.
